Cohen Department of Computer Science University of Denver Applying the ideas introduced in the companion book, Computer Algebra and Symbolic Computation: Elementary Algorithms, this book explores the mathematical concepts that form the basis for computer algebra software and describes algorithms for algebraic. Polynomial Algorithms in Computer Algebra Texts and mongraphs in symbolic computation 1. For several years now I have been teaching courses in computer algebra at the Universitat Linz, the University of Delawa.

Computer algebra

Embed Size px x x x x Computer algebra is the eld of mathematics and computer science that isconcerned with the development, implementation, and application of algo-rithms that manipulate and analyze mathematical expressions. This bookand the companion text, Computer Algebra and Symbolic Computation:Mathematical Methods, are an introduction to the subject that addressesboth its practical and theoretical aspects. This book, which addressesthe practical side, is concerned with the formulation of algorithms thatsolve symbolic mathematical problems, and with the implementation ofthese algorithms in terms of the operations and control structures avail-able in computer algebra programming languages. Mathematical Methods,which addresses more theoretical issues, is concerned with the basic math-ematical and algorithmic concepts that are the foundation of the subject. Both books serve as a bridge between texts and manuals that show howto use computer algebra software and graduate level texts that describealgorithms at the forefront of the eld. These books have been in various stages of development for over 15years.

Skip to search form Skip to main content You are currently offline. Some features of the site may not work correctly. DOI: Cohen Published Computer Science. Mathematica, Maple, and similar software packages provide programs that carry out sophisticated mathematical operations. Applying the ideas introduced in Computer Algebra and Symbolic Computation: Elementary Algorithms, this book explores the application of algorithms to such methods as automatic simplification, polynomial decomposition, and polynomial factorization.

computer algebra and symbolic computation elementary algorithms

Skip to search form Skip to main content You are currently offline. Some features of the site may not work correctly. DOI: Cohen Published Computer Science. This book provides a systematic approach for the algorithmic formulation and implementation of mathematical operations in computer algebra programming languages. The viewpoint is that mathematical expressions, represented by expression trees, are the data objects of computer algebra programs, and by using a few primitive operations that analyze and construct expressions, we can implement many elementary operations from algebra, trigonometry, calculus, and differential equations.

Computer Algebra — Software for Symbolic Mathematics — also a Possibility for Chemistry?

A computer algebra system CAS or symbolic algebra system SAS is any mathematical software with the ability to manipulate mathematical expressions in a way similar to the traditional manual computations of mathematicians and scientists. The development of the computer algebra systems in the second half of the 20th century is part of the discipline of " computer algebra " or " symbolic computation ", which has spurred work in algorithms over mathematical objects such as polynomials. Computer algebra systems may be divided into two classes: specialized and general-purpose. The specialized ones are devoted to a specific part of mathematics, such as number theory , group theory , or teaching of elementary mathematics. General-purpose computer algebra systems aim to be useful to a user working in any scientific field that requires manipulation of mathematical expressions.

Software-Entwicklung in der Chemie 2 pp Cite as. Fit 1—2,Loo,Pav, Mac. This even though the first application in chemistry goes back to ! We sketch the background and describe applications in physics — the main field for applications of computer algebra.

Computer Algebra and Symbolic Computation: Mathematical Methods

Computer algebra and symbolic computation: mathematical methods. / Joel S. Cohen the portable document format (PDF), which is displayed with the Adobe.

In mathematics and computer science , [1] computer algebra , also called symbolic computation or algebraic computation , is a scientific area that refers to the study and development of algorithms and software for manipulating mathematical expressions and other mathematical objects.

